See the advanced advanced networking page to set up source based routing. In the action tables section of the policy based routing page, select a static route table. Policy based routing and nat fortinet technical discussion. I will show you how to configure policy based routing. A policybased route pbr specifies criteria for selecting packets and.
Policy conditions consist of a variety of selection criteria that act as filters for policy based routing routing rules. By attaching pbr for that route map on selected interface the router knows which packets arriving on what interface will be subject to pbr rule that we created above. Policybased routing is supported only in the default system routing mode. Configure policy based routing to send network traffic, a router usually examines the destination address in the packet and looks at the routing table to find the nexthop destination. Pbr policy rules have priority over static and dynamic routes in the routing table. Using policy based routing pbr with sonicwall firewall and. In your network you may need to get a strategy for routing and setup your routing in some varios reasons such as security, load balancing, routing decision, monitoring and etc. A policybased routing rule is an aclaccess control list. Enter a name for the policy based routing pbr table for example, isp1. Create a routing instance and import route from inet0 to r1. Chapter 25 configuring policybased routing policybased routing configuration task list the set commands can be used in conjunction with each other. Policy based routing 5900 hewlett packard enterprise.
Sep 25, 2018 configuring a policy based routes pbr6 for ipv6 traffic. These commands are evaluated in the order shown in step 3 in the previous task table. Policybased routing can be used to change the next hop ip address for traffic matching certain criteria. Policy based routing based on port number fortinet.
In the policy rules section of the policy based routing page, click add. Open voyager configurations traffic management policy based routing. To setup a sonicwall for policy based routing to be used with the websense content gateway there are several steps that need to be completed. On the assumption that policybased routing negates route rules in the ddwrt openvpn client set up, i tried a different approach. Traffic can be filtered based on source addresses, destination addresses, source port range, destination port range, protocol, job name, security zone, and security label. Cisco config example for policy based routing network. Set the priority of the rule an integer between 1 and 32765. In the cisco ios, pbr is implemented using route maps. Up until this point, we have had one default route out to the internet for the many vlanssubnets that terminate on the core switch. First is policybased routing, when a nexthop choice is made by some policy.
Policybased routing is not supported with layer 3 portchannel subinterfaces. The match ip address 20 command in the example matches traffic that is based on standard ip acl 20. For example this may be a routemap or simple a packet filter forwarding a packet to gateway basing on its ip header fields values second is multiple fib support. How to use the cisco ios policybased routing features petri. Watchguard multiwan ve policy based routing youtube. Screenos what is the difference between a policybased vpn. Pbr is used to route ip unicast packets based on a policy.
The wiki has been moved to the same repository as the current firmware code. Doing that i have internet connection, but it s natting the outgoing traffic by default with the ip of the interface. A policybased routing pbr rule is an acl that can forward traffic as normal, or route traffic over a vpn tunnel specified by an ipsec map, routed to a nexthop router on a nexthop list, or redirected over an l3 gre tunnel or tunnel group. Policy conditions consist of a variety of selection criteria that act as filters for policybased routing routing rules. Policy based routing 5900 hewlett packard enterprise community. The routemap command is used to enable policy routing on the router. To send network traffic, a router usually examines the destination address in the packet and looks at the routing table to find the. Enhanced version of asuss router firmware asuswrt legacy code base rmerlasuswrt merlin. If multiple match statements are called within a single route map instance, all match statements must match for the route map instance to yield a true result. Configuring route maps and policybased routing in a nutshell, route maps work in the following manner. With policybased routing, there is a difference between traffic that is going through the router and traffic that is originated from the router. To apply policy routing to a range of ports, type the starting port number in the from field and the ending port number in the to field. A quick introduction to linux policy routing scotts weblog. You can use the policy tab settings to create access rules that define the source and destination of traffic the policy handles.
Using null policy based routes to drop outgoing packets. Screenos what is the difference between a policybased. I am currently trying to confgure this on a hp5406zl. An acl used in a policy based routing route map cannot include deny access control entries aces.
Freebsd supports pbr using either ipfw, ipfilter or openbsds pf. When enabled, you can implement policies that selectively cause packets to take different paths. In some cases, you want to send traffic to a different path than the default route specified in the routing table. Policy based a policy based vpn is a configuration in which a specific vpn tunnel is referenced in a policy whose action is set as tunnel. Policybased routing pbr provides a flexible mechanism for forwarding data packets based on polices configured by a network administrator. The goal of policy based routing is to make the network as agile as possible. How to direct traffic using policy based routing nsk7100. I was getting timeouts of all sorts with no reason and reading online you see all sorts of attempts from people to work around. Acls let traffic be classified based on the content of the packets layer 3 and layer 4 headers. It supports match and set commands that are required. The icon below indicates that the policy is configured for a bidirectional tunnel.
How to configure policy based routing check point software. Now under normal situations this is fine, but when the traffic on your network requires a more hands on. What youre looking for has two possible methods of achieving. Linux supports multiple routing tables since version 2. We want that for example packet that is sourced from host a to server is crossing router r2 on its way, and that packets from host b. Second the xlite applications should go to isp2 but my problem i do not know what is the port number of the. Ive found myself in a situation where my isp, notorious for having problems with certain online services not to mention putting everyone under a permanent nat started misbehaving with sonys playstation network. This can be useful to overrule your routing table for certain traffic types.
Policy based routing based on port number hi engineers, can you please help me on how to setup a policy based routing. In addition to dynamic and static routing, you can use policy based routing pbr to control traffic. Ip standard or extended acls are used to establish the pbr match criteria using the match ip address command. Policybased routing bases routing decisions on criteria that you specify. Every packet coming on this interface is verified against the policy and only traffic conforming matching the rule is. Protocolindependent configuration guide, cisco ios xe everest 16.
Configuring policybased routing policybased routing configuration examples qc47 cisco ios quality of service solutions configuration guide the source209. Pbr is applied to int vlan 2 on 5900 on the left hand side. Setup watchguards policy based routing technology and. Activate the check box in use policy based routing and set the interface. Select the check box for a policy and select action edit policy. You can also configure sdwan routing, application control, geolocation, ips, bandwidth and time quotas, static nat, or server load balancing. Using policy based routing pbr with sonicwall firewall. Its when an ip stack of the operating system has multiple forward information base tables. How to direct traffic using policy based routing nsk. How to configure a probe to monitor a nexthop of a routemap on knsseries.
Policybased routing, handled by the router or openvpn. Policy based routing pbr is a technique that forwards and routes data packets based on policies or filters. I have taken over an installation of a m440 with minimal documentation. A policy based vpn is a configuration in which a specific vpn tunnel is referenced in a policy whose action is set as tunnel. Policy based routing overview policy based routing pbr provides a flexible mechanism for forwarding data packets based on polices configured by a network administrator. To add policybased routing to a policy, from fireware web ui. Chapter 34 configuring policybased routing pbr configuration examples for pbr interface configuration on efp bd svi interface ten gig 01 switchport switch mode trunk switchport trunk allowed vlan non service instance ether 10 encap dotq1 100 bridgedomain 100 interface vla100 ip address 10. Monitoring policy based routing check point software. The ip routecache policy is command used for fastswitched pbr and you dont need it for cefswitched pbr. Policy based routing pbr is a mechanism by which traffic is routed through specific paths with a specified qos using acls. The example above is for traffic that went through our router. Hi all i just need some adviceconfirmation ive set a policy based routing so traffic sourced from 10.
How to configure multiple pbr rules for 1 routemap policy. Support for advanced policybased routing midstream is introduced in junos os release 15. Rfc 1104 models of policy based routing ietf tools. An acl used in a policybased routing route map cannot include deny access control entries aces. Policy based routing is not supported with layer 3 portchannel subinterfaces. Jul 29, 2015 in this article, i will discuss one of the new features that is supported on the cisco asa, starting from version 9. Next we need to define the interface where will the pbr wait for packets to enter in the process of policy based routing. Say that we wanted to find any traffic that is destined for ip device 10.
Policy based routing is an enhanced form of load balancing with rules that define the interfaces that traffic is routed through. By defining routing behavior based on application attributes, pbr provides flexible, granular traffichandling capabilities for forwarding packets. Policybased routing is not supported with inbound traffic on fex ports. Use the policy tab to set basic information about a policy, such as whether it allows or denies traffic. After some googling there are three solutions to this problem. Forwarding of traffic to different ips based on destination ip and port number is called policy based routing. Acl is a common way of restricting certain types of traffic on a physical port. Policy routing is used in situations where it is desirable for certain packets to be routed some way other than the obvious shortest path, such as to provide equal access, protocolsensitive routing, sourcesensitive routing, routing based.
Every packet coming on this interface is verified against the policy and only traffic conforming matching the rule is subject to policy route. The problem that many network engineers find with typical routing systems and protocols is that they are based on routing the traffic based on the destination of the traffic. In computer networking, policybased routing pbr is a technique used to make routing decisions based on policies set by the network administrator. Chapter 25 configuring policy based routing policy based routing configuration task list the set commands can be used in conjunction with each other. One thing of note is this guide is intended to assist in the setup but is not supported by websense or its employees. Use the ip policy priority command to control if the routemap will be used before the route table first,after the route table last or just traffic matching the routemap is forwarded only. This is a quick example of using rules without an extra routing table. Policybased routing is an enhanced form of load balancing with rules that define the interfaces that traffic is routed through. May 29, 20 a quick introduction to linux policy routing 29 may 20 filed in education. With policybased routing, based on the application of originating the traffic, policies to select the network that will be used for outbound traffic can be easily defined.
Policy based routing is supported only in the default system routing mode. Configure policybased routing to send network traffic, a router usually examines the destination address in the packet and looks at the routing table to find the nexthop destination. In order for us to be able to control which traffic goes over which dsl connection, the interface has to be defined for the fwrules which are supposed to go over the 2nd dsl connection gateway 1 ext2. Here i want to tell you about the trick that can implement policy based routing on windows and this solution is completely free. It is easily implemented on linux unix systems and on cisco routers, but is unavailable on windows systems. If route maps are applied in a policyrouting environment, packets. A policy based routing pbr rule is an acl that can forward traffic as normal, or route traffic over a vpn tunnel specified by an ipsec map, routed to a nexthop router on a nexthop list, or redirected over an l3 gre tunnel or tunnel group. There used to be many unsupported features that discouraged placing the asa at the edge and pbr was one of them. The first part describes rfc 1102, and the second part describes cisco white paper about policy routing. Ive followed many guides and in each of them this seems to be correct, so i create a route table, i add a route to it and then i add a rule for qualifying traffic to use this table. Check point gaia web portal overview part 2 advanced routing, bgp, ospf, dhcp relay, rip duration. The two common approaches used by troubleshooters are to check for frequently encountered difficulties and easily tested conditions. Policy base routing in this article you can know what is pbr policy base routing and how it work with one example.
Policy based routing on the cisco asa intense school. Policy routing is a mechanism for routing packets, based on policies or rules set by the network manager. We want that for example packet that is sourced from host a to server is crossing router r2 on its way, and that packets from host b are going to the same server but across router r3. Configuring policybased routing policybased routing configuration task list qc45 cisco ios quality of service solutions configuration guide the set commands can be used in conjunction with each other. How to configure policy based routing 7 configuration before you configure pbr, make sure that the firewall has been configured and is working. Srx how to configure advanced policybased routing apbr. When a packet arrives at a gaia security gateway, the gateway goes through the pbr. All other packets for which the router has no explicit route to the.
Suppose you want to block access to facebook and dont want to use netfilter or other mechanisms. Policy based routing and nat hi, i have a situation with two internet providers and i am using a policy route to force the traffic of a specific dmz into the wan2 provider. Policy based routing pbr fundamentals select the contributor at the end of the page the problem that many network engineers find with typical routing systems and protocols is that they are based on routing the traffic based on the destination of the traffic. My understanding is, that because there is a more specific route than the default route received by dhcp on fa01 in the fib, it overrides the pbr and traffic from fa00. Advanced policybased routing techlibrary juniper networks. What i am trying to accomplish is define which vlans can communicate and make a policy to route internet traffic. In computer networking, policybased routing pbr is a technique used to make routing decisions based on policies set by the network administrator when a router receives a packet it normally decides where to forward it based on the destination address in the packet, which is then used to look up an entry in a routing table. My understanding of policy based routing in linux is that there are three main components, the routing tables, the routes and the rules. The tunnel icon appears as either a lock or as a lock with directional arrows as shown in the sample below. There used to be many unsupported features that discouraged placing the asa at the edge and pbr was one of. Policy based routing pbr routing offers the possibility to forward traffic based on defined criteria without verifying the ip routing table.
For example, assume your organization has multiple physical locations. To configure policy based routing pbr configure action tables to configure static routes to destination networks. Policy based routing on windows with freeware tools. Technically its not policybased routing, but its based on similar principles. It would help if you can show me some screenshots on how to setup it up to follow. It is configured with wan failover between our fiber and cable circuits. However, in some cases, there may be a need to forward the packet.
Policybased routing on 4500x we have a 4500x vss at the core of our network. Policy based routing rmerlasuswrtmerlin wiki github. Configuring route maps and policybased routing you can use route maps to permit or deny the information found true by the match statements. Policy based routing on windows with freeware tools experts.
Instead of using policybased routing to include certain ips, i used source based routing to send certain traffic through the isp gateway. I am trying to apply policy based routing directly to the fa00. In this post, im going to introduce you to policy routing as implemented in recent versions of ubuntu linux and possibly other linux distributions as well, but ill be using ubuntu 12. Configuring a policybased routes pbr6 for ipv6 traffic. They are evaluated in the order shown in step 3 in the previous task table. Policy based routing may also be based on the size of the packet, the protocol of the payload, or other information available in a packet header or payload. In this article, i will discuss one of the new features that is supported on the cisco asa, starting from version 9. To perform policy routing based on the port on which the packet is received, type the same port number in the from and to fields. Policy based routing is not supported with inbound traffic on fex ports.
1080 588 144 544 736 767 141 178 1248 1468 191 652 881 324 415 1116 1125 251 978 1236 1503 294 741 231 101 1452 630 877 219 1221 731 1055 407 1030 1183 918 428